The story of Yuan Yamori
Yuan Yamori, a Michelin-starred soba restaurant in Tsukishima, Tokyo, opened its doors in 2014 with a vision to honor traditional soba-making techniques. The founder, inspired by the rich culinary heritage of Japan, sought to create a space where seasonal ingredients could shine through meticulously crafted dishes. The restaurant operates on a reservation-only basis, ensuring an intimate dining experience that emphasizes personalized service.
Milestones and growth
- 2014: Yuan Yamori opened in Tsukishima, Tokyo.
- 2018: Selected for Tabelog Soba 'Hyakumeiten' (Top 100 Soba Restaurants).
- 2019: Again selected for Tabelog Soba 'Hyakumeiten'.
- 2022: Selected once more for Tabelog Soba 'Hyakumeiten'.

Discovering Yuan Yamori: Tokyo's Michelin-Starred Soba Gem in Tsukishima Districts 3-chōme-9-7
Nestled in a quiet back alley of Tokyo’s vibrant Tsukishima neighborhood, Yuan Yamori stands out as a Michelin-starred soba restaurant celebrated for its artisanal approach to this traditional Japanese noodle. The restaurant's fresh buckwheat flour is ground by hand using a stone mill, guaranteeing soba noodles that are prepared and served at their peak flavor and texture. Guests seeking an intimate dining experience will appreciate the cozy counter seating and the option of a private room, ideal for savoring the thoughtfully crafted soba kaiseki courses. The traditional Japanese-style interior further enhances the authentic atmosphere, making each visit a cultural journey as well as a culinary delight.
What Makes Yuan Yamori Unique and Appealing
Yuan Yamori’s dedication to quality and tradition shines through its menu, which exclusively features soba and seasonal ingredients without any fried foods, sushi, or typical Japanese sides like tempura or rice bowls. This focus on simplicity and freshness appeals to those who appreciate healthy dining and the pure flavors of soba. Moreover, the restaurant requires reservations, ensuring a personalized and unrushed atmosphere for each guest. A cash-only policy is in place, yet electronic money is accepted, streamlining payment while preserving the restaurant's intimate scale.

A Culinary Journey with the Soba Kaiseki Course
At Yuan Yamori, the star of the show is the exquisite Soba Kaiseki Course, a thoughtfully curated multi-course meal priced at 8,800 JPY. This elegant course showcases the versatility and delicate flavors of soba through a series of dishes ranging from starters and mains to unique desserts. Each element is prepared with meticulous care, highlighting the stone-milled buckwheat’s natural aroma and texture.
The soba is hand-ground fresh upon your arrival, ensuring that noodles are served at their absolute peak. The course begins with delicate soba miso and tiger blowfish soba porridge, followed by seared bonito and soba brat rich in aroma and flavor even without condiments. Warm soba noodles feature simply seaweed as a topping, while the juicy Juwari Seiro Soba allows pure enjoyment of the buckwheat’s earthy notes without dipping sauce. The meal culminates with a refreshing soba-based dessert that leaves a lasting impression.
